Thank You

San Carlos, California (650) 209-7208

Staff Picks

train decorated in Christmas lights

All Aboard!

As the holiday season makes its way to California, Fremont has its own unique way of celebrating it with the Train of Lights! Located at the Niles Canyon Railway about a half hour from our San Carlos hotel, the trip is worth it, as this is a rare opportunity to ride through the canyon at night, with refreshments and live music. Read more